
Charleston Athletic Fund Records Another Record Year
8/3/2023 2:33:00 PM | General
CHARLESTON, S.C. - The College of Charleston Athletic Fund has set yet another record-breaking fundraising year. CAF's annual fund, the Cougar Club, raised a record $1.5 million during the 2022-23 fiscal year, marking an increase from the $1.1 million raised the previous year. The annual fund raises money specifically directly to assist with student-athlete scholarships.
"I would like to take this opportunity to thank the CAF Board and our staff for their outstanding efforts to again increase the amount of support," said Jerry Baker, Executive Director of the Cougar Club. "Our numbers are a true testament to the great support of our loyal members and fans. Our supporters find a way every year to continue and upgrade their support for our student/athletes and coaches."
Under the direction of Baker, CAF has recorded a record-breaking year each fiscal year since 2018. In total, CAF raised $5.9 million for the athletic department through special fundraising events, sport-specific giving and other initiatives. Funding from the Charleston Athletic Fund provides financial resources to more than 350 student-athletes competing in 19 varsity sports at The College.
"On behalf of our student-athletes, coaches and staff, we would like to thank the thousands of fans that continue to raise the bar in their support of Charleston Athletics. Not only did we achieve record levels of donations this past year, all of our external revenues experienced new all-time highs thanks in large part to the 31-win season for our men's basketball team," said Director of Athletics Matt Roberts. "From ticket sales, sponsorships, licensing, and concessions, it is clear that this program is on the rise. We look forward to more growth this year."
